Will Larter left this review about The Earl of St Vincent

This is a pleasant, fairly small, village pub in the narrow and twisty back streets near the delightful church, and largely dependent on the food trade from tourists, by the looks of things. Named after a British admiral from the Napoleonic wars, who was called John Jervis but took his name when elevated to the peerage from his famous victory at the Battle of Cape St. Vincent (14 February 1797), off the coast of Portugal. The fact that more of my review is about the eponymous hero than about the pub is that this was my seventh pub of a day that started at 11:30 at the Blisland Inn, and I hadn't taken any notes here after failing in my struggle to connect to wifi.

I arrived here shortly before 6pm when it was relatively quiet and also - welcomingly - fairly cool inside after a warm, sunny day. My half of St Austell Tribute was in very good condition (NBSS 3.5), which is just as well as it was the only cask beer on the bar, despite the presence of two other hand pumps; this on a Saturday in summer in a tourist town in Cornwall. Most customers seemed to be asking for Madri or Cruzcampo, god help us.
